      My father tells a story from Lille, 1995. He was with a Brit tour group watching the Europa Cup. Sitting close to the TJ pit he witnessed Jonathon Edwards' 18.43m and was so shocked all he could do was point and shout words to the effect of "OMG, Holy ****". Those around him asked, "What Ron, what?". They'd all missed it as they were scribbling down results from the scoreboard and cross-referencing them against the form chart
